Archaeology Notes

ND36NE 8022 c. 383 675

N58 35.5 W3 3.7

NLO: Freswick [name: ND 370 675]

Freswick House [ND 377 670]

Freswick Bay [name: ND 383 675]

Sinclair's Bay [name centred ND 36 56].

Formerly also entered as ND36NE 8006 at cited location ND c. 37 67 [N58 35 W3 5].

Conisbay [Canisbay], 15th Nov. The ADELAIDE (sloop), Swanson, of and for Thurso, from Shields, with coals, got ashore in Freswick bay about 8 a.m. to-day, and has become a total wreck: wreck strewed about the beach: crew saved.

Source: LL, No. 16,099, London, Wednesday, November 15 1865.

NMRS, MS/829/72 (no. 10873).

(Classified as sloop: no cargo specified, but date of loss cited as 15 November 1865). Adelaide: this vessel was wrecked in Freswick Bay. Capt. Swanson.

Registration: Thurso. 52nrt.

(Location of loss cited as N58 35.33 W3 4.0).

I G Whittaker 1998.

The location assigned to this record is essentially tentative.

Information from RCAHMS (RJCM), 10 May 2007.
